Standings for 2020-2021 season
Rk | Team | % Victory | Gp | Gw | GL | Pts+ | Pts- | Pts+ /g | Pts- /g | Diff | Expected Winning % |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Milwaukee Bucks | 68.2 | 22 | 15 | 7 | 2428 | 2312 | 110.4 | 105.1 | 5.3 | 66.4 |
2 | Phoenix Suns | 63.6 | 22 | 14 | 8 | 2398 | 2300 | 109.0 | 104.5 | 4.5 | 64.1 |
3 | Philadelphia 76ers | 58.3 | 12 | 7 | 5 | 1395 | 1305 | 116.3 | 108.8 | 7.5 | 71.7 |
4 | Brooklyn Nets | 58.3 | 12 | 7 | 5 | 1350 | 1274 | 112.5 | 106.2 | 6.3 | 69.1 |
5 | Atlanta Hawks | 55.6 | 18 | 10 | 8 | 1913 | 1940 | 106.3 | 107.8 | -1.5 | 45.1 |
6 | Utah Jazz | 54.6 | 11 | 6 | 5 | 1286 | 1295 | 116.9 | 117.7 | -0.8 | 47.6 |
7 | Los Angeles Clippers | 52.6 | 19 | 10 | 9 | 2120 | 2043 | 111.6 | 107.5 | 4.1 | 62.6 |
8 | Dallas Mavericks | 42.9 | 7 | 3 | 4 | 742 | 778 | 106.0 | 111.1 | -5.1 | 34.1 |
9 | Denver Nuggets | 40.0 | 10 | 4 | 6 | 1148 | 1203 | 114.8 | 120.3 | -5.5 | 34.3 |
10 | Portland Trail Blazers | 33.3 | 6 | 2 | 4 | 717 | 725 | 119.5 | 120.8 | -1.3 | 46.1 |
11 | Los Angeles Lakers | 33.3 | 6 | 2 | 4 | 585 | 624 | 97.5 | 104.0 | -6.5 | 29.0 |
12 | New York Knicks | 20.0 | 5 | 1 | 4 | 485 | 520 | 97.0 | 104.0 | -7.0 | 27.5 |
13 | Memphis Grizzlies | 20.0 | 5 | 1 | 4 | 575 | 617 | 115.0 | 123.4 | -8.4 | 27.3 |
14 | Boston Celtics | 20.0 | 5 | 1 | 4 | 561 | 617 | 112.2 | 123.4 | -11.2 | 21.0 |
15 | Washington Wizards | 20.0 | 5 | 1 | 4 | 550 | 620 | 110.0 | 124.0 | -14.0 | 15.9 |
16 | Miami Heat | 0.0 | 3 | 0 | 3 | 285 | 365 | 95.0 | 121.7 | -26.7 | 3.1 |
Standings glossary
Stats abbreviations
- Rk: rank
- % Victory: number of win / number of games played
- Gp: number of games played
- Gw: number of games won
- GL: number of games lost
- Pts+: total number of points scored by the team
- Pts-: total number of points scored by opposing teams
- Pts+ /g: total number of points scored by the team per game
- Pts- /g: total number of points scored by opposing teams per game
- Diff: difference between points scored and received per game
- Expected Winning %: through our basketball statistical database and the use of advanced stats, we are able to project a team’s win percentage which then allows us to project how many wins a team is expected to have. These projections are a unique way to understand whether a team has played better or worse than their record indicates.
